Course overview
Graduates with a Graduate Certificate in Information and Communications Technology are ready for many different positions in business. The course gives you the skills enter the industry with a base for further experience or study. Graduates will be prepared for success in contemporary organisations and prepared to take on the industrys trends, responsibilities, needs and opportunities.
